Biodiversity in Devil’s Swamp
Devil’s Swamp is a habitat bursting with life! From captivating flora to a diverse range of fauna, it showcases nature’s incredible artistry. The swamp is home to myriad species, including vibrant birds, elusive mammals, and a variety of aquatic life.
Birdwatchers rejoice: Situated along migratory pathways, Devil’s Swamp attracts an array of bird species. You might spot herons perched on cypress knees, while colorful kingfishers dart above the water. The air fills with the sounds of chirping and flapping wings, creating a symphony of nature that is both calming and exhilarating.
The swamp plays a crucial role in maintaining biodiversity. Its wetlands promote thriving ecosystems, providing habitats for amphibians and fish while supporting countless plant species that filter the water and stabilize the soil. Furthermore, this delicate balance highlights the significance of conservation efforts, underscoring the importance of preserving such valuable ecosystems.

Safety Tips for Your Visit
While exploring the mysterious Devil’s Swamp, taking precautions is essential to ensure an enjoyable and safe adventure. Here are some important safety tips:
- Wear appropriate attire: Dress in layers and wear waterproof clothing and sturdy footwear to stay comfortable throughout your visit.
- Stay hydrated: Bring plenty of water to keep yourself hydrated, especially during hot summer months.
- Follow marked trails: To avoid getting lost or damaging fragile ecosystems, stick to designated trails and paths.
- Be aware of wildlife: While wildlife viewing is one of the joys of visiting the swamp, maintain a safe distance from any animals you encounter.
- Check weather conditions: Before heading out, look at the weather forecast, as conditions can change rapidly in swampy areas.
